Easy to install
Having a cat flap installed is a great method to allow your cats access to the garden as well as your home without having to open the door each time. It also keeps them secure, preventing burglars and other pets from entering. There are many options for cat flaps, it's important to choose one suitable for your pets' size and lifestyle. It might take some time to get them used to the new door. But it's worth the effort.
Be sure to have everything you require before you begin installing the cat flap. These include a jigsaw or hole saw (for wooden doors) as well as a drill and a masonry bit (for brick walls) and the appropriate sealants and adhesives. Clear the area: Take away any obstructions or obstacles that might hinder your work.
Draw the outline of the cat flap on the door or wall. It is crucial to do this carefully to avoid making mistakes or creating damage. Make use of a spirit-level to ensure that the outline is straight and centered.
Once you have marked the outline you can start drilling and cutting. To get the best results, you should make use of a jigsaw, or hole saw to cut the opening, following the manufacturer's guidelines regarding size and shape. Place the cat flap into the opening, and secure it by using screws or fasteners. If you're installing the cat flap in a wooden door, consider painting the edges of the cut-out to protect the flap from weather damage.
Test the flap for your cat before you close it by letting your pet walk through it. If they're hesitant to enter, you can try giving them treats and encouraging them to go through the door. Alternately, prop the door open for the first couple of weeks to help them get used to the idea. Make sure to program the cat flap using the collar tag of your pet or microchip. If you have cat flaps that have a microchip, you should program it prior to installing the cat flap. This will prevent you from accidentally programming a neighbor's pet following the installation.
